How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Georgetown Crossing?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Georgetown Crossing Studio Apartments | $834 | $725 | $1,316 |
Georgetown Crossing 1 Bedroom Apartments | $983 | $597 | $1,460 |
Georgetown Crossing 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,307 | $995 | $2,250 |
Georgetown Crossing 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,595 | $1,274 | $2,445 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Georgetown Crossing
How much are Studio apartments in Georgetown Crossing?
There are currently 5 Studio Apartments in Georgetown Crossing with rent ranges from $725 to $1,316 with an average price of $834.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Georgetown Crossing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Georgetown Crossing ranges from $597 to $1,460 with an average monthly rent of $983.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Georgetown Crossing c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Georgetown Crossing range from $995 to $2,250.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,307.
How expensive are Georgetown Crossing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 14 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Georgetown Crossing on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,274 to $2,445 - averaging $1,595 for the location.
